222 Riverside Dr Unit 11E
Listing Notes
Rare Riverside Retreat: Oversized 1BR with a Large Private Balcony in the desired 222 Riverside Drive Condominium Upper West Side.~ Perfectly positioned on Riverside Drive, directly across from the greenery of Riverside Park and steps to 96th Street Express subway station, this rarely available oversized 1BR Condo offers a combination of scale, light, and outdoor living that is increasingly hard to find.The Great Room: A Rare Sense of Scale- Generous Proportions: Approximately 965 sq. ft. of living space with high ceilings.~ The heart of this home is the exceptional 2210 x 153 living and dining area. Unlike the narrow common layouts, this expansive Great Room provides a sense of volume and flexibility rarely seen in a one-bedroom.- Northern Exposure: Bright and views bring in consistent natural light throughout the day.- Private Outdoor Oasis: Step out onto your large private balcony to enjoy open city and river views; perfect for morning coffee or sunset dining.- Seamless Flow: The layout is designed for both grand-scale entertaining and quiet, peaceful living.Apartment Highlights- King-Sized Bedroom: Features a walk-in closet and ample space for a dedicated home office setup.- Windowed Kitchen: Bright and functional with significant storage.- In-unit washer/dryer and abundant closet space throughout.The Building & Lifestyle~ 222 Riverside Drive is a premier full-service condominium located steps from the 96th Street express subway and the Hudson River Greenway.- Amenities: 24-hour doorman/concierge, live-in resident manager, fitness center, bike storage, and on-site garage.- Nature at Your Door: Located directly across from Joan of Arc Park, offering immediate access to riverfront paths and open sky.Note: There is an ongoing assessment of $616.32/month through December 2026.
